World Military Games: National football team wins Cup beating Egypt (1-0)
ALGIERS- The Algerian military football team has won late in the evening of Saturday, World Military Cup “Brazil-2011” by defeating Egyptian counterpart by a score of (1-0) in Rio de Janeiro (Brazil).
The only goal of the game was scored by striker Sid Ahmed Aouadj at 17th minute of the first half.
The brawl erupted right after the final whistle as Egypt missed out on winning their sixth football gold medal at the Military Games, thanks to a first-half goal from Algeria’s Awad Sayed.
Television cameras caught Egypt forward Ahmed Eid, who is widely criticized by local media for his fiery temper which dearly cost him over the past few years, chasing an Algerian player before catching him with a kung fu-style kick.
The vicious attack led to a free-for-all, with players from both sides aiming punches and kicks at each other in a scene reminiscent of the sort of violence which blighted many of the matches between Egypt and Algeria’s senior teams over the past 30 years.
